  1. Há 17 horas · The United States Courts of Appeals or circuit courts are the intermediate appellate courts of the United States federal court system. The list includes both "active" and "senior" judges, both of whom hear and decide cases. Of the thirteen US courts of appeals, twelve are divided into geographical jurisdictions.

  6. Há 3 dias · This article was originally published in The Legal Intelligencer on May 28, 2024. This April, the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Seventh Circuit took aim at what are typically referred to as “mootness fees” in Alcarez v. Acorn, 99 F.4th 368 (7th Cir. 2024).
